Sust student stabbed to death by muggers on campus

Students blocked the Dhaka-Sunamganj road at 12am on Tuesday, protesting the incident

Update : 26 Jul 2022, 11:54 AM

A student of Shahjalal University of Science and Technology (Sust) has been stabbed to death by a mugger on campus.

The deceased is Bulbul Ahmed, a third-year student of the Public Administration Department.

The incident took place near Gazikalur Tila area inside the campus on Monday evening, Assistant Proctor Abu Hena Pahil confirmed.

He said Bulbul along with his friends went to area in the evening. At one stage, a mugger stabbed him in his chest. 

Bulbul was first rushed to the university medical centre and later shifted to Sylhet MAG Osmani Medical College Hospital (SOMCH) where on-duty doctor Kaniz Fatema declared him dead around 7:45pm.

Sylhet SOMCH police outpost In-Charge Sub Inspector (SI) Alamgir said that the student was brought to the hospital dead around 8pm.

Hearing the news, Sust vice-chancellor, student’s welfare advisor, among others, visited the deceased student.

The university Register Mohd Ishfaqul Hussain filed an FIR in this regard with Jalalabad police station on Monday. 

Students demand safe campus

Sust students blocked the Dhaka-Sunamganj road at around 12am on Tuesday, protesting the incident.

On Monday, several students and Sust unit Bangladesh Chhatra League (BCL) held meetings and staged demonstrations on campus, said Assistant Proctor Abu Hena Pahil.

According to sources, Bulbul was a member of Sust unit BCL. 

Meanwhile, various organizations of the university also held meetings and rallies demanding safe campus.
